IPhone 17 Becomes World’s Best-Selling Smartphone In Q2 2026, Apple Dominates Top 3
iPhone 17 Has Once Again Been the Worlds Best Selling Smartphone Report
iPhone 17 has once again been the world’s best-selling smartphone, according to the global smartphone sales ranking released by Counterpoint Research.
The standard model of the iPhone 17 has retained its position as the world’s bestselling smartphone, capturing 6% of global smartphone sales in the second quarter of 2026. Meanwhile, Apple’s premium smartphones, iPhone 17 Pro Max, and iPhone 17 Pro, have respectively ranked second and third best-selling smartphones globally.

Apple Secures Top Three Positions in Global Smartphone Ranking
Apple’s strong position in the global smartphone market was particularly palpable in the latest global smartphone ranking, as its smartphones secured the top three positions.
iPhone 17 came out as the world’s best-selling smartphone, followed by the iPhone 17 Pro Max and iPhone 17 Pro.
This means that Apple’s smartphones swept the global smartphone sales rankings in Q2 2026. Counterpoint Research notes that Apple’s unit sales grew by 5% year-over-year in Q2 2026, despite a significant global smartphone market decline during the quarter.
iPhone 17 Dominates Global Smartphone Sales Rankings
One of the key factors which drove the demand for the iPhone 17 was that the standard model offers several upgrades compared to the previous generation, as well as being significantly less expensive than the Pro Max and Pro models.
Furthermore, Counterpoint Research notes that iPhone 17 sales were particularly strong across several key markets, including India, Japan, and the Middle East and Africa region. Counterpoint Research also reports that Apple’s smartphone sales in South Korea nearly doubled year-over-year due to the demand for the iPhone 17.

Apple and Samsung Are Represented in the Top Ten Global Smartphones
The top ten global smartphones are represented by two smartphone manufacturers – Apple and Samsung. Specifically, Counterpoint Research reports that Apple and Samsung’s combined top smartphones accounted for 26% of global smartphone sales, achieving the highest representation for any June quarter. Samsung secured five positions in the top ten list, while Apple’s smartphones also secured five positions. The five best-selling Apple smartphones are: iPhone 17, iPhone 17 Pro Max, iPhone 17 Pro, iPhone 17e, and iPhone 16. Galaxy S26 Ultra was Samsung’s best-selling smartphone in Q2 2026.
Samsung Galaxy S26 Ultra Is the Best-Selling Android Smartphone
Samsung’s Galaxy S26 Ultra was the best-selling Android smartphone in Q2 2026, ranking fourth in the global smartphone sales ranking. Counterpoint Research notes that the Galaxy S26 Ultra marked the first time that an ultra-premium Samsung smartphone was the best-selling Android smartphone in a June quarter.
Samsung’s Galaxy A series remained a popular choice among budget-conscious smartphone buyers due to its compelling value offer, wide distribution, and extended software support.
iPhone 17 Is One of the Most Popular Smartphones in India
India has become one of the most important markets for Apple, which is why Counterpoint Research released a separate analysis of smartphone sales in India. In particular, the iPhone 17 5G has been a best-selling smartphone model in India, ranking seventh with 3% of market share in Q2 2026. The OPPO A6X 5G was the bestselling smartphone in India in Q2 2026 with 4% of market share. In addition to the iPhone 17 5G, iPhone 16 is also among the five best-selling smartphones in India.
iPhone 17 Sales Surge Despite Global Smartphone Market Challenges
The strong sales of iPhone 17 came as the global smartphone market declined year-over-year in Q2 2026. Smartphone manufacturers faced significant supply chain pressures, as semiconductor prices continued to rise, while RAM shortages impacted the supply of several critical components. Counterpoint Research notes that smartphone manufacturers are shifting towards a more focused product strategy, as the smartphone market consolidates around fewer devices. As a result, the top ten smartphones accounted for 26% of global smartphone sales in Q2 2026.
Apple and Samsung were able to benefit from the trend, as both companies were able to leverage their strong smartphone franchises and extensive global distribution networks to promote their flagship products.
Top Ten Best-Selling Smartphones in Q2 2026
Based on Counterpoint Research, the following smartphones secured positions in the global top ten best-selling smartphone ranking:
Position Smartphone
- 1 Apple iPhone 17
- 2 Apple iPhone 17 Pro Max
- 3 Apple iPhone 17 Pro
- 4 Samsung Galaxy S26 Ultra
- 5 Samsung Galaxy A07 4G
- 6 Samsung Galaxy A17 5G
- 7 Apple iPhone 17e
- 8 Samsung Galaxy A17 4G
- 9 Samsung Galaxy S26 5G
- 10 Apple iPhone 16
